Project Accountant Salaries
How much do Project Accountant earn in United States? The average salary of Project Accountant is $68,030 in United States
$68,030 /yr
Additional Cash Compensation Information Icon
Average $68,030
Range $60K - $70K
Last updated February 09 2024
The average pay range for Project Accountant is between $60K and $70K. Salaries vary from a low of $50K up to $90K per year. The average number of Project Accountant roles advertised per month is 34 in United States between April 2023 and November 2023.
